Litter bins are an essential component of street furniture, providing a practical solution for waste disposal in public spaces and contributing to a cleaner and more organized urban environment. Single litter bins are designed to be standalone units, typically placed strategically in locations such as parks, streets, and near commercial establishments to encourage proper waste disposal. These bins are crafted from durable materials like stainless steel, plastic, or concrete to withstand various weather conditions and frequent use.
The design of single litter bins varies to complement different urban aesthetics, from sleek, modern styles to more traditional and robust models. They are equipped with features such as easy-access openings, odor control systems, and sometimes, segregation compartments for recycling purposes. Additionally, these bins often include secure fittings to prevent tampering and vandalism, making them a reliable choice for maintaining cleanliness in public areas. Their placement and functionality play a critical role in promoting environmental responsibility among citizens, making them a vital element of urban furniture.
